EXPLANATION TEXT

DEFINITION AND EXAMPLE
Definition:
An explanation text tells us how or why something occurs. It concerns about the steps rather than the things. It is meant to tell each step of the process (ho) and to give any reasons (why).

Social Function:
To explain the processes involved in the formation or workings of natural or socio cultural phenomena.

Generic Structure of a recount text:
·         A general statement to position the reader.
·         A sequenced explanation of why or how something occurs.

Significant Lexicogrammatical features:
·         Focus generic, non-human participants.
·         Use mainly of Material and relational processes.
·         Use mainly of temporal and causal Circumstances and Conjunctions.
·         Some use of passive voice to get Theme right.
